#421c80 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#421c80 is composed of 25.9% red, 11%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.4% cyan, 78.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 262.8 degrees, a saturation of 64.1% and a lightness of 30.6%. #421c80 color hex could be obtained by blending #8438ff with #000001.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#421c80 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#421c80 has RGB values of R:66, G:28,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 4332672.

Shades and Tints of #421c80
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08030f is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#421c80
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e4c50 is the less saturated color, while #3c0498 is the most saturated one.
